O knihe:

This Handbook brings together reasons why and how to engage in reflective inquiry. It presents an existing body of practice and research, knowledge for understanding and engaging in reflective inquiry. The task for this Handbook is to advance the domain significantly by placing present-day trends in historical and theoretical contexts and identifying what professionals need to be educated for and for what they may be at risk if they are not. One needed goal is to clarify the ways people interrogate their professional practice, the puzzles they encounter, and how they gather and evaluate evidence that can help them act on their experiences and create and articulate meanings of them. It is time for a fuller, more capacious review of this important body of knowledge so that it may inform and help further delineate the discipline and the education of professionals. It is this challenge that a group of accomplished authors take up in this Handbook. Here we bring together essential perspectives of practitioners, researchers and theoreticians who are working or have worked to bring clarity and definition to the endeavor. The goal is to make this work available in a ready reference text so that teachers and researchers of professionals may have a surer hold on the work they seek to achieve in contributing to a still emerging discipline and the growth and development of professionals. This Handbook pulls together a body of research and of knowledge of a domain of knowing, reflective inquiry, and explores how it is construed as an intellectual framework, a set of conceptual tools, that can shape actions, practices, and understandings across a range of professions and as an epistemological perspective, provide a way of looking at knowing and how we know. This Handbook is meant to be a resource for professional educators and other academics from several professions currently engaging in reflective practices or interested in doing so, as well as adult educators, counselors and psychologists concerned with adult learning.
